6. Sword Art Online (Aincrad)

Aincrad, the incredible floating castle from Sword Art Online, is a dream come true for gamers. This virtual world features 100 distinct floors, each with its own beautiful scenery, dangerous monsters, and exciting challenges. Players can fully immerse themselves in the game, crafting weapons, battling foes, and forming connections with others. Aincrad’s stunning visuals and intricate details create a mesmerizing experience, and the feeling of growing stronger and learning new abilities is incredibly rewarding.

The biggest danger in Aincrad is that dying in the game means dying in real life. Although being stuck inside a game sounds terrifying, the incredibly immersive and detailed world makes it an experience you’ll never forget.

2. One Piece (The Grand Line)

The world of One Piece is incredibly expansive and full of adventure. The Grand Line offers pirates a dream setting with its many mysterious islands, strange creatures, and hidden treasures. From the unique lands of Skypiea to the incredible underwater world of Fish-Man Island, One Piece is packed with imaginative places. As a pirate in this world, you can team up with a crew, sail into the unknown, and search for the legendary One Piece treasure.

The Grand Line is famously both thrilling and incredibly dangerous. Pirates and monstrous sea creatures are just some of the constant challenges. However, the freedom, strong friendships, and the lure of adventure make it impossible to resist for those who crave excitement.
